Job Summary

The successful candidate will be a key member of the multi-disciplinary CAMHS Service, working closely with the Youth Justice Service to provide mental health assessments and interventions for vulnerable children and young people. This role involves early intervention, ensuring access to mental health advice and support, and navigating local mental health systems. The post holder will provide consultation, training, and advice to YJS staff, parents, and other agencies.

Main Responsibilities
  1. Conduct high-quality mental health assessments for children and young people referred to YJS, as indicated.
  2. Identify the need for assessment through liaison with the Police, Courts, Probation, YJS, CAMHS, and other relevant agencies for young offenders with mental health issues.
  3. Provide access to a range of quality psychotherapeutic interventions, assessing, planning, implementing, and evaluating therapeutic approaches.
  4. Offer consultation to YJS practitioners.
  5. Provide clinical and managerial supervision to the wider CAMHS team.
  6. Work as a co-therapist with other MDT members, as appropriate.
  7. Manage a complex caseload, undertaking case management responsibilities.
  8. Contribute to the development of the Oldham CAMHS Youth Justice Care Pathway.
About Us

The Oldham CAMHS Youth Justice care pathway is a targeted service for children and young people open to the service. It provides a consultation, assessment, and treatment care pathway for those identified as having mental or emotional health difficulties. The pathway is informed by the Greater Manchester Thrive Framework for system change, promoting a collaborative and needs-led provision of services.
